Action at Okinawa 17 May to 21 June [ 1945]. Photographs by Photographers of Ships of Task Force Thirty-One.
Photographers, Task Force 31.
no place : Task Force 31, ca. 1945..

Very good in glossy cover. Bound with a bates fastener. Slight scuffing and wear to edges and corner of cover. Last page slightly browned. 10 p. w/ 2 photos per page. A very scarce small military publication of small ship naval losses around Okinawa from shore batteries and kamikaze attacks. Includes scarce photographs of the explosion of the Longshaw (DD 559), loss of the William D. Porter (DD 579), Bates (APD 47), and PC 1603, damage to an APD called Roper, decoy ships, Hagushi and Naha harbors, and more.

How Austria-Hungary Waged War in Serbia: Personal Investigations of a National.
Reiss, R. A.
Paris : Librairie Armand Colin, 1916..

1st printing in English. Good in faded blue paper covers. Stringbound. Covers starting to brown at edges. Cover has 1 inch tear at top near spine, and a 2 inch tear from bottom near spine. 49 p. w/illustrations. An important pamphlet used for propaganda (though much of what it says is true) against the Austro-Hungarians. It details though pictures, reports, and statistics various atrocities against the Serbs, including murder of prisoners and civilains and an extensive section on the use of dum-dum exploding bullets.
